elaioplast
English
Etymology
Compound from Ancient Greek: ἔλαιον (élaion, “olive oil”) and πλαστός (plastós, “formed”).
Noun
elaioplast (plural elaioplasts)
- (biology) A specialized leucoplast responsible for the storage of lipids.
